Spatial transcriptomics data from the lungNENomics cohort of lung neuroendocrine tumours
Ontology highlight
ABSTRACT: This dataset contains spatial transcriptomics data of four lung neuroendocrine tumours (lung NETs), a rare and understudied type of lung cancer. The dataset consists of raw sequencing data, metadata, and gene expression matrices. It is part of the lungNENomics project. See https://doi.org/10.5281/zenodo.19366762 for processed data for the series, including downstream analyses data for the four samples in this dataset, such as inferred CNVs and aneuploidy status, and spatial domain and cell proportions for each spot. The lungNENomics project also generated other molecular data for a series of more than 200 samples. The raw sequencing data (fastq files for RNA-seq, cram files for WGS, and idat files for methylation arrays) is hosted on the European Genome-Phenome Archive website, study EGAS00001005979. Medical imaging data (Hematoxylin & Eosin stained whole-slide images) from the lungNENomics project is hosted in the EBI bioImage Archive (10.6019/S-BIAD3143).
